by Sigrid Nunez
First published 1997
Nona lives in New York at forty, trapped in endless self-analysis. She has a solid marriage but throws it away for an affair that disappoints her. The relationship crumbles, leaving her to examine where everything went wrong. She cannot stop thinking about herself and her choices. Her mind circles through past mistakes and present troubles. She watches the people in her life through the lens of her own dissatisfaction. The affair promised something better but delivered something worse. Now she faces the wreckage of what she had and what she wanted. Her thoughts become a prison of regret and second-guessing. The decent life she abandoned haunts her as she tries to understand her own destructive impulses.
